WBSC releases groups, locations for 2019 Premier12®

MEXICO CITY, Mexico- Canada’s journey to securing a spot in the 2020 Olympic Games in Tokyo will begin in Seoul, Korea this November after the World Baseball Softball Confederation (WBSC) announced the three opening round groups and host locations for II WBSC Premier12® event that will be staged from November 2-17, 2019.

The top team in the Premier12 final standings from the Asia/Oceania territory (not including automatically qualified Japan) and the top finisher from the Americas will gain direct entries into the six-team Olympic Baseball competition at the Tokyo 2020 Games, without having to go through additional qualifiers. 

Canada, ranked No. 10 in the world according to the latest WBSC world rankings, is part of Group C featuring host and world No. 3 Korea, No. 5 Cuba and No. 7 Australia. All Group C games will take place at Seoul’s Gocheok Sky Dome.

Group A will take place at Charros Baseball Stadium in Jalisco, Mexico with No. 6 Mexico joined by No. 2 USA, No. 8 Netherlands and No. 12 Dominican Republic, while Group B, to be held at Intercontinental Stadium in Taichung, Taiwan, will feature host No. 4 Chinese Taipei, No. 1 Japan, No. 9 Venezuela and No. 11 Puerto Rico.

The top two teams from each group will advance to the six-team Super Round, which will be hosted by Japan’s Nippon Professional Baseball (NPB) league and played at Chiba’s ZOZO Marine Stadium and the iconic Tokyo Dome, where the championship final will also be played.

The WBSC also launched the official 2019 Premier12 website -- premier12.wbsc.org/2019 -- in six languages, including English, French, Japanese, Korean, Spanish and Traditional Chinese.
